Sawndip Tools
This site provides information on digital tools for dealing with Sawndip, the traditional writing system for Zhuang.
To display or print Sawndip the first thing you need is to have suitable fonts installed. The fonts need to cover both those Sawndip that are already in Unicode, and those which are not.
